What is an Industrial AI platform?

An Industrial AI platform is software that enables manufacturers to build, deploy, and operate AI on operational data from plant systems — machines, control systems, historians, and MES.



The term describes two distinct layers of software that are frequently treated as one category. The application layer supplies models and use cases: vision inspection, predictive maintenance, process optimization, agentic workflows. The data layer supplies and governs the operational data those models run on, connecting it from control systems, contextualizing it with asset relationships, units, and time, and maintaining lineage so output can be traced back to its source signal. A third architecture, distinct from both, embeds AI directly into ERP and asset management workflows and operates on transactional and planning data rather than plant-floor signals.



What separates an Industrial AI platform from an Industrial IoT platform is scope rather than degree. IIoT platforms were built for connectivity, device management, and monitoring. Industrial AI additionally requires contextualization of signals into asset models, governance sufficient for model output to be traceable, and the ability to run inference where the latency budget requires it — including locally, inside the plant, in environments where data cannot leave the site.



At enterprise scale the defining requirement is repeatability across sites: standardized data models common to every plant, and centralized management of models and versions across them.
